What’s the best way to have an infant and a devoted, attentive, loving dog? Breeds, training and advice?
This is basically a theoretical, planning-ahead sort of question. I don’t have a spouse, a house and can’t get another dog at the moment.
But many people on here and elsewhere say that having a dog when you have an infant isn’t a good idea. I agree, but I also see so many stories about babies growing up with wonderful, protective dogs.
If I ever have a kid, I definitely want a dog that is so devoted and so protective of him. The kind you read stories about… shielding the kid from the fall-off of the balcony, protecting the baby from rattlesnakes, that babies learn to walk holding on to…
So… if you wanted a dog like this and didn’t have a kid yet, what would be your strategy?
I realize having a baby and puppy at the same time isn’t a good idea. But if you get a dog a year or two before the baby… What breeds would you think are the best choices for infants? What kind of training would you do before the baby came (like, before the baby was even created)?
If you’re giving suggestions for breeds, I prefer rarer breeds. Just a personal preference, but I’d be more interested in breeds that aren’t in the top 10 or even top 20 or 30 maybe.
A few breeds I’ve thought might be a good fit include Greater Swiss Mountain Dogs and American Foxhounds. But I haven’t done extensive research. These are just two breeds I’ve come across in my reading that seem like good fits.
